Timezone in Lakeshore
Lakeshore operates on Central Standard Time, which is UTC-6. During Daylight Saving Time, the area shifts to Central Daylight Time, which is UTC-5. Daylight Saving Time in Lakeshore begins on the second Sunday in March, when clocks are set forward one hour, and ends on the first Sunday in November, when clocks revert to standard time.
This timezone places Lakeshore one hour behind the Eastern Time Zone, which includes major cities like New York and Washington, D.C. This difference means that if it is noon in Lakeshore, it is 1 PM in New York.
